Comparing Thailand with Juneau, Alaska

Compare Climate information for Thailand and Juneau, Alaska

Is Thailand warmer or hotter than Juneau, Alaska?

On average across the year, yes, Thailand is hotter than Juneau, Alaska . Thailand has an average temperature of 28°C/82°F and Juneau, Alaska has an average temperature of 6°C/43°F.

Thailand's hottest month is May, with an average maximum temperature of 36°C/97°F, which is hotter than Juneau, Alaska's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 18°C/64°F).

Is Thailand colder or cooler than Juneau, Alaska?

On average across the year, no, Thailand is not colder than Juneau, Alaska . Thailand has an average minimum temperature of 24°C/75°F and Juneau, Alaska has an average minimum temperature of 3°C/37°F.



Thailand's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of 20°C/68°F, which is not colder than Juneau, Alaska's coldest month (February, with an average minimum temperature of -5°C/23°F).

Does Thailand have more rain than Juneau, Alaska?

On average across the year, no, Thailand has less rain than Juneau, Alaska. Thailand has an average annual rainfall of 1394mm and Juneau, Alaska has an average annual rainfall of 1936mm.

Thailand's wettest month is September, with an average monthly rainfall of 246mm, which is wetter than Juneau, Alaska's wettest month (also September, with an average monthly rainfall of 233mm).
